Tour 1
Hong Kong thru the Lens - Central
Meet at Central's Statue Square by the entrance to the subway (MTR exit K). Here we will be able to photograph many landmark buildings in the financial centre of Hong
Kong as well as visit the oldest outdoor street market of Hong Kong. We will then visit Hollywood road temple and the Cat street flea market. The walk will wind down the
back streets of Sheung Wan area where a lot of "local colour" can still be found. The walk will end at the Sheung Wan MTR station.

Tour 2
Hong Kong thru the Lens - Kowloon
Meet at the Central Star Ferry pier (next to IFC 2) and we will cross the harbour to Tsim Sha Tsui (TST) via
the historical Star Ferry boat. In TST we will walk along the "Avenue of the Starts" promenade and see breathtaking views of the Hong Kong island skyline across the
harbour. We will then proceed inland towards Yaumatei and complete the walk at the Temple Street night market.
